The epic conclusion to the Phenomena trilogy by Brian Michael Bendis (cocreator of Miles Morales, Jessica Jones, and Naomi) and Andre Lima Araujo (A Righteous Thirst for Vengeance) Phenomena is the story of a young boy named Boldon, a mysterious girl named Matilde, and the warrior Spike--survivors of a phenomena that took over Earth years ago. Not an apocalypse . . . something far more interesting.

After Matilde faces her past in Valentia Verona, Boldon realizes that he has unfinished business to settle. Worried, Spike and Matilde chase their unusually serious friend all the way to the rumored birthplace of the phenomena. This is where it happened. But what is it?

The closer the trio get to their destination, the more Boldon reveals about his past--he wasn't "cast out" of his tribe like he's been claiming throughout their adventures together. In fact, he ran away. He ran away from something so bad that he can barely bring himself to speak of it.

What is it that is waiting for our ragtag band of heroes? What is the secret behind the phenomena? Spike is reunited with his legendary brotherhood of Warriors just in time to face and impossible evil brought on by none other than Boldon's family. In such dire circumstances, what kind of hero could possibly rise to the call?

In The Secret, the Phenomena trilogy comes to a thrilling conclusion. Brian Michael Bendis and Andre Lima Araujo pull back the curtain to reveal all the secrets behind their universe. With unforgettable characters, full-tilt action, stunning imagination, and world-building, Phenomena is perfect for fans of Avatar: The Last Airbender.
